Malea Cesar embraces bigger role in Filipinas’ title defense

Summary by Tiebreaker Times
Once the youngest member of the squad, Malea Cesar now finds herself stepping into a leadership role as the Philippine Women’s National Football Team prepares to defend its title at the 2025 ASEAN MSIG Serenity Cup in Vietnam. At just 21 years old, Cesar has already earned 30 international caps — a testament to her steady presence and growing influence within the team.
